This palette was so intriguing because of the stunning range of shades, it’s quite diverse and bold, something I don’t have a lot of in my collection – my favourites tend to be full of browns, pinks/purples, nudes and golds, I don’t have a lot of purely colourful palettes so I was very excited about this one.

Although on first glance it looks slightly terrifying (there are such bold colours in there) it actually contains a lot of beautiful daytime shades; ‘Universal’ is the most gorgeous purplish brown that I’m already obsessed with. I’ve used this palette lots since receiving it and I nearly always reach for this shade as my darkest outer V colour – I’ve used it for everyday work eyes, too, and it has really decent staying power. My eyes are hooded so eyeshadow tends to crease a lot on me, especially during the working day when I don’t have time to properly prep the lids.

You can see in the above picture just how pigmented these shadows are, the shimmers are gorgeous and so glittery. I haven’t used them yet but the blues are breathtaking and I can’t wait to play with them.

I love this purple spotlight eye so much I’ve actually done it twice, using almost all of the same colours but interchanging a few here and there – these also work beautifully with some of the shades from the Huda Beauty New Nude Palette. The below was a really simple daytime casual look using mainly ‘Celestial’ which is a beautiful pink glittery shade. See, not so scary after all!

I absolutely love this palette, I knew I would from all the others I’ve gotten over the years but it feels like these are even more pigmented and they blend so easily!
